House Bill 4074 of 2021 (Public Act 54 of 2022)

Education: curriculum; program of instruction in free enterprise and entrepreneurship; encourage in school districts and public school academies. Amends 1976 PA 451 (MCL 380.1 - 380.1852) by adding sec. 1166b.

History

(House actions in lowercase, Senate actions in UPPERCASE)
Note: A page number of 1 indicates that the page number is coming soon
Date Journal Action
2/02/2021 HJ 5 Pg. 71 introduced by Representative Tommy Brann
2/02/2021 HJ 5 Pg. 71 read a first time
2/02/2021 HJ 5 Pg. 71 referred to Committee on Education
2/03/2021 HJ 6 Pg. 76 bill electronically reproduced 02/02/2021
5/04/2021 HJ 38 Pg. 629 reported with recommendation without amendment
5/04/2021 HJ 38 Pg. 629 referred to second reading
5/18/2021 HJ 44 Pg. 836 read a second time
5/18/2021 HJ 44 Pg. 836 placed on third reading
5/19/2021 HJ 45 Pg. 852 read a third time
5/19/2021 HJ 45 Pg. 852 passed; given immediate effect Roll Call # 212 Yeas 95 Nays 13 Excused 0 Not Voting 2
5/19/2021 HJ 45 Pg. 852 transmitted
5/20/2021 SJ 46 Pg. 787 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ON EDUCATION AND CAREER READINESS
2/02/2022 SJ 9 Pg. 90 REPORTED F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
2/02/2022 SJ 9 Pg. 91 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
3/16/2022 SJ 27 Pg. 354 REPORTED BY CO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
3/16/2022 SJ 27 Pg. 354 SUBSTITUTE (S-1) CONCURRED IN
3/16/2022 SJ 27 Pg. 354 PLACED ON ORDER OF THIRD READING W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
3/17/2022 SJ 28 Pg. 367 PASSED ROLL CALL # 92 YEAS 21 NAYS 17 EXCUSED 0 NOT VOTING 0
3/17/2022 SJ 28 Pg. 367 IMMEDIATE EFFECT DEFEATED
3/17/2022 SJ 28 Pg. 367 INSERTED FULL TITLE
3/17/2022 HJ 28 Pg. 396 returned from Senate with substitute (S-1) with full title
3/17/2022 HJ 28 Pg. 396 laid over one day under the rules
3/22/2022 HJ 29 Pg. 410 Senate substitute (S-1) concurred in
3/22/2022 HJ 29 Pg. 410 roll call Roll Call # 131 Yeas 96 Nays 9 Excused 0 Not Voting 1
3/22/2022 HJ 29 Pg. 410 full title agreed to
3/22/2022 HJ 29 Pg. 410 bill ordered enrolled
3/23/2022 HJ 30 Pg. 442 presented to the Governor 03/23/2022 02:54 PM
4/12/2022 HJ 32 Pg. 475 approved by the Governor 03/30/2022 11:01 AM
4/12/2022 HJ 32 Pg. 475 filed with Secretary of State 04/01/2022 04:34 PM
4/12/2022 HJ 32 Pg. 475 assigned PA 54'22
